    Abstract: A magnetic head has a pair of magnetic core halves opposed to each other with a non-magnetic material posed therebetween to form a magnetic gap, which head includes a pair of magnetic core halves, a first ferromagnetic metal thin film and a second ferromagnetic metal thin film. The magnetic core halves are formed of ferromagnetic oxide such as Mn-Zn ferrite, and they have opposing surfaces opposed to each other to provide the magnetic gap. The first ferromagnetic metal thin film formed of Fe-Si-Al alloy is formed at least on one of the opposing surfaces. The second ferromagnetic metal thin film formed of Fe-Si-Al alloy having different constituent ratio from the first ferromagnetic metal thin film is formed between the magnetic gap and the first ferromagnetic metal thin film. The flux density of the second ferromagnetic metal thin film induced when a magnetic field of 1.2K oersted is applied exceeds 1000 gauss.

    Abstract: An assembly and method for securing head suspension members on shelf segments of metallic or ceramic actuator arms in a disk drive. The assembly comprises an actuator arm with a reduced thickness shelf segment, at least one head suspension member, a staking member having particular attributes and a staking plate also having particular attributes. The assembly is designed such that forcible expansion of the staking member takes place exclusively within the material of the staking plate member. The method is formulated such that the constituent elements of the assembly are aligned, placed under compression and staked together wherein an interference fit is formed between the staking member and staking plate member and no forcible pressure from the staking procedure is transmitted to the actuator arm. The assembly and method are ideally utilized in a multi-disk disk drive in which a plurality of head suspensions are secured to multiple arms of a single actuator in a single procedure.

    Abstract: A computerized video record rental system and method in which a video record unit such as a tape cassette is provided with an integral counting device for counting the number of times the record is played. Upon rental and return of the record, the counts are recorded in computer memory, together with an identification of the record unit, and the computer computes the rental fee due based on the net play count for the record unit. A central computer is provided at a location remote from the rental sites. The computers at the rental sites are connected to the central computer periodically by way of modems and telephone lines. The central computer is similarly linked to computer terminals located at the record owners' places of business. Rental information is gathered from the rental sites in the central computer, which reports rental figures to the owners.

    Abstract: A disc drive unit for rotating a data storage disc such as an optical disc or a magnetic disc comprising a turntable for supporting and rotating the disc, and a motor for rotating the turntable. The turntable also functions as a rotor of the motor. At least one driving magnet is mounted on the turntable in opposing relationship with at least one coil of the motor. At least one attraction magnet for securely holding the disc in position on the turntable is securely mounted thereon. One yoke functions as yokes, each of which must be provided for each of two kinds of magnets. When the turntable is made of a plastic, at least one attraction magnet and/or at least one driving magnet is defined by partially magnetizing the turntable at at least one predetermined region thereof. The turntable is securely attached to the bearings so that it rotates about a shaft having one end securely fixed to a stationary portion of the motor.
